安装express: npm install express
时间: 2025-07-16 15:28:30 浏览: 5
### 3.10 使用 npm 安装 Express 包的方法
在使用 npm 安装 Express 包之前,需确保系统中已安装 Node.js 和 npm。Node.js 可以从其官方网站下载并安装,npm 会作为其一部分自动安装[^1]。安装完成后,可以通过运行 `node -v` 命令来检查当前系统的 Node.js 版本是否满足 Express 的安装要求(需要 0.10 版本以上)[^2]。
进入目标项目目录后,例如 `myapp`,执行以下命令对项目进行初始化:
```bash
cd myapp
npm init
```
此操作将生成一个包含项目配置信息的 `package.json` 文件。接下来即可通过 npm 安装 Express 包,具体命令如下:
- 如果希望将 Express 安装为项目的生产依赖项,可以使用以下命令:
```bash
npm install express --save
```
该命令会将 Express 添加到 `node_modules` 目录,并更新 `package.json` 文件中的 `dependencies` 字段,同时也会修改 `package-lock.json` 文件[^4]。
- 如果希望将 Express 安装为开发依赖项,则可以使用以下命令:
```bash
npm install express --save-dev
```
这会将 Express 添加至 `node_modules`,并更新 `package.json` 文件中的 `devDependencies` 字段[^2]。
完成安装后,可以通过编写一个简单的 Express 应用程序测试其功能。创建一个名为 `express_demo.js` 的文件,并写入以下代码:
```javascript
var express = require('express');
var app = express();
app.get('/', function(req, res) {
res.send('Hello World');
});
var server = app.listen(8081, function() {
var host = server.address().address;
var port = server.address().port;
console.log("Application Demo, visit http://%s:%s", host, port);
});
```
运行上述脚本后,访问 `http://localhost:8081` 即可看到 "Hello World" 的输出结果[^3]。
此外,如果需要安装特定版本的 Express,可以在命令中明确指定版本号,例如安装 4.17.1 版本:
```bash
npm install [email protected] --save
```
该命令会将指定版本的 Express 安装到 `node_modules` 并更新 `package.json` 和 `package-lock.json` 文件。
### 示例命令总结
```bash
# 初始化项目
npm init
# 安装 Express 作为生产依赖
npm install express --save
# 安装 Express 作为开发依赖
npm install express --save-dev
# 安装指定版本的 Express
npm install [email protected] --save
```
通过上述步骤,可以顺利地在项目中使用 npm 安装 Express 包,并根据实际需求将其归类为生产或开发依赖。
阅读全文
相关推荐


















